POI : Fungoida
Type : Stabitis
Name : Fungoida Stabitis - Orange

First discovered for ExTool : Torloisk
Organisms that live deep inside a planetary substrate. They share similar morphology to fungi but are not saprophytic, instead their mycelial body drives its metabolism through chemosynthetic and thermosynthetic processes. These are facilitated by the substrate which also protects the organism from environmental extremes. The exposed aspects of the organisms are primarily involved in reproduction. This is frequently through spore ejection, but certain species also support gaseous exchange with the atmosphere. Some fungoicla exhibit bioluminescent behaviours as part of a metabolic process involved in the breakdown of accumulated toxins.

A species of fungoida that thrives on geothermal energy. and can produce two-metre high tower structures composed of tightly clustered cylinders.
